Samsung launches budget Galaxy M14 with a 50MP rear camera and massive battery

What you need to know

  • Samsung Galaxy M14 goes on sale in Ukraine.
  • The budget handset has a 90Hz display, a 50MP camera and a 6,000mAh battery.
  • The Galaxy M14 comes in two storage variants and starts at ~$222.

Samsung announced (opens in new tab) New budget smartphones of the Galaxy M series on the Ukrainian market. The device is called Galaxy M14 and the base variant starts at UAH 8299 (~$222).

As pointed out by MySmartPrice, the Galaxy M14 is a 5G-ready budget device with a 6.6-inch Infinity-V LCD display. It features Full HD+ resolution and supports 90Hz refresh rate.

The Galaxy M14 is powered by a fairly mid-range Exynos 1330 processor with a Mali G68 GPU for graphics. It comes in two storage variants with 4 GB or 6 GB of RAM and 64/128 GB of onboard storage. The device also supports external microSD up to 1TB.

Despite being the company’s budget device, it sports a triple rear camera system with a 50MP primary camera next to two 2MP lenses that act as depth and macro cameras. The Galaxy M14 relies on a 13MP selfie shooter.
